Talk to Paul at Maximillian's. I have a 71 '02 as well and wanted to change the non inertia belts to the inertia kind. He told me that they carry the belts which were installed in the Turbo '02 and will work in a 71. The mounting point for the shoulder restraint is not on the cross member which seperates the the front window from the rear (like in the later 2002's) but under the rear passenger door panel where a nut should be welded which accepts the shoulder restraint bolt. I actually ordered these belts but returned them since I was able to acquire a nice set of original belts (the previous owner had cut off the shoulder restraints for the front seats making the belts secured only at the lap). The "Turbo" type belts were around $130 - $140 a side...
